Parts Advisor - Hayes
Parts Advisor – Hayes
Salary & Benefits
Salary: competitive + overtime + life assurance + healthcare + car scheme + pension + 33 days’ holiday (including bank holidays) + industry-leading discounts and more fantastic benefits
Shifts Available
Weekdays
- Dayshift: 6:00 am – 2:30 pm (Mon-Fri)
- Backshift: 2:30 pm – 10:30 pm (Mon-Fri)
Saturdays
1 in 3 Saturdays paid at overtime (7 am – 1 pm)
About the Role
As a Parts Advisor, you will play a key role in supporting the efficient operation of the parts department by providing thoughtful service to both internal and external customers.
Your responsibilities include:
- Supplying parts and components to workshop technicians.
- Managing goods received and ensuring accurate stock control.
- Handling customer sales enquiries, processing orders, and providing professional product advice.
- Supporting urgent workshop requirements to minimise vehicle downtime.
The role demands proactive communication, strong organisational skills, and customer-focused attention to detail.

What You’ll Do
- Supply parts and components promptly to workshop technicians.
- Identify and source correct parts using electronic catalogues and manufacturer systems.
- Assist with urgent workshop requirements to minimise vehicle downtime.
- Receive, inspect, and process incoming deliveries.
- Serve retail and trade customers professionally and efficiently.
- Provide product advice and technical parts information.
- Handle calls regarding parts availability, pricing, and orders.
- Maintain accurate stock records and support stock control.
- Participate in stock counts and inventory audits.
Who We’re Looking For
To excel in this role, you should:
- Hold a driving licence.
- Be able to identify and work with parts using catalogues and systems.
- Have numerical aptitude for managing part numbers.
- Demonstrate strong communication skills, both written and verbal, with internal teams and external customers.
- Have selling and persuasive abilities to influence parts sales.
- Be competent in documentation and accurate record-keeping.
- Be technologically literate, with skills in DMS (Document Management System) and associated software.
- Be proactive, enthusiastic, and approachable with a flexible and positive attitude to changes.
